Comedy, Hip-Hop, and Activism: My Interview with Mad in America

Art, Interviews, Mental HealthBy jimflannery2022-10-12

In anticipation of  the release of my hip-hop album, Sorry It’s Not Funny, I was interviewed by Karin Jervert of Mad in America. My interview with the Alliance for Self-Directed Education

Education, InterviewsBy jimflannery2019-05-16

Thanks to Alex Khost at the Alliance for Self-Directed Education for interviewing me for their online magazine, Tipping Points! In the interview, I speak a lot about the crossover between issues in our education system and mental health system as they related to human rights and self-direction. Hope you enjoy!
